Draw for World Cup 2026 International play-off has been made

Article image:Draw for World Cup 2026 International play-off has been made

The draw for FIFA's new International Play-Offs have been made in Zurich.

Six teams from five confederations have made it to the final round of qualifying for next summer's World Cup with two nations earning their place amongst the 48 in USA, Canada and Mexico.

Due to their current FIFA ranking, DR Congo and Iraq have been given an automatic bye into the finals next March

But the four remaining teams have learned their fate in today's draw.

The games are ...

Path 1

Semi-final: New Caledonia v Jamaica

Final: DR Congo v winner of SF 1

Path 2

Semi-final: Bolivia v Suriname

Final: Iraq v winner of SF 2

Matches will take place in Guadalajara and Monterrey on March 23 with the finals four days later.
